COAL MINING SAFETY AND HEALTH REGULATION 2017 - REG 250A

Action to be taken if automatic methane detector non-operational in roof fall

250A Action to be taken if automatic methane detector non-operational in roof fall

(1) An underground mine must have a standard operating procedure for taking action if—
(a) a roof fall causes an automatic methane detector mentioned in section 243A to fail in service; and
(b) the detector cannot be immediately replaced or repaired.
(2) The procedure must provide that—
(a) the automatic methane detector or the cable for the detector must be replaced or repaired as soon as practicable; and
(b) the armoured face conveyor or the longwall shearer may be operated—
(i) only to clear the roof fall or recover the cable for the detector; and
(ii) only while the conditions mentioned in subsection (3) apply.
(3) For subsection (2) (b) (ii) , the conditions are—
(a) the ERZ controller uses a portable methane detector to continuously monitor the general body concentration of methane in the area of the roof fall; and
(b) the general body concentration of methane in the area of the roof fall is less than 1.25%; and
(c) the general body concentration of methane at the longwall face and in the longwall return airway is less than 2%.
